Output 90863c968bf812ee828a21f649ef4e0d95bd1d5f8f44bc8879caebe5239958c0: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7508b260a47ff65c8442c2f5ac3187dc798d9fe2 OP_EQUAL
address
3CMqQFXYuKWeh7SayETDyo1S3F2qfRh4iP
transaction
90863c968bf812ee828a21f649ef4e0d95bd1d5f8f44bc8879caebe5239958c0
spent
true